免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发如何分工

APP开发是一个复杂而庞大的工程,需要多个人员协作完成。在开发过程中,分工合理与否直接影响到项目的进展和质量。下面我将介绍APP开发的分工原则和具体的分工内容。

1. 项目经理:负责项目的整体规划和管理,与客户进行沟通,制定项目计划和时间表,协调各个角色的工作,确保项目按时、按质完成。

2. UI/UX设计师:负责APP的界面设计和用户体验,包括界面布局、色彩搭配、图标设计等。他们需要深入了解用户需求和行为习惯,设计出符合用户期望的界面。

3. 前端开发工程师:负责开发APP的前端界面和交互逻辑。他们需要熟练掌握HTML、CSS、JavaScript等前端技术,能够将设计师的界面设计转化为可交互的用户界面。

4. 后端开发工程师:负责开发APP的后端功能和数据处理。他们需要熟悉服务器端开发语言和数据库技术,能够处理用户请求、存储数据等后端逻辑。

5. 数据库管理员:负责设计和管理APP的数据库,包括数据表结构设计、数据备份与恢复等工作。他们需要熟悉数据库管理系统和SQL语言。

6. 测试工程师:负责对APP进行全面的测试,包括功能测试、性能测试、兼容性测试等。他们需要编写测试用例,发现并修复软件中的缺陷。

以上是APP开发中常见的角色和分工,实际项目中还可能根据具体需求有所调整。在分工的过程中,需要注意以下几点:

1. 合理分工:根据项目规模和需求,合理划分各个角色的工作内容,避免出现重复劳动或工作遗漏的情况。

2. 协作沟通:各个角色之间需要保持良好的沟通与合作,及时解决问题和协调工作进度。

3. 技术能力:各个角色需要具备相应的技术能力,能够胜任自己的工作内容。同时,也要有学习能力和团队合作精神,能够与其他角色进行知识交流和技术分享。

4. 进度控制:项目经理需要对项目进度进行有效的控制和管理,及时发现并解决工作中的问题,确保项目按时完成。

总之,APP开发的分工需要考虑到项目的需求和规模,合理划分各个角色的工作内容,保持良好的沟通和协作,确保项目的顺利进行和高质量的完成。


相关知识:
三亚html5混合式app开发
HTML5混合式App开发是一种结合Web技术和原生App开发技术的一种方式。在这种开发方式中,我们可以使用Web技术来开发App的界面和功能,同时还可以使用原生App开发技术来实现一些高级功能和操作。相比于传统的原生App开发方式,HTML5混合式App
2024-01-10
app开发者前景如何
APP开发者是目前互联网领域一个非常热门的职业,随着智能手机的普及和移动互联网的快速发展,APP已经成为人们生活中不可或缺的一部分,APP开发者的前景非常广阔。首先,我们来了解一下什么是APP。APP(Application,全称Application P
2023-06-29
app开发难处
随着移动互联网的发展,手机APP已经成为人们日常生活中必不可少的工具。这也让APP开发越来越受到关注。但是,APP开发并不简单,其中存在着许多难处。下面将详细介绍APP开发的难处。一、平台适配性问题移动设备市场的竞争非常激烈,各种类型的移动设备层出不穷,导
2023-06-29
app开发的经费预算
APP开发是目前很多公司和个人关注的领域之一,不同的APP需求,其经费预算自然也不同。本文将就APP开发的经费预算原理和相关细节进行介绍。一、APP开发的经费构成APP开发的经费构成主要包含以下几个方面:1. 开发团队工资及福利:开发团队包括项目经理、开发
2023-06-29
app 开发草图
移动应用程序设计已成为互联网时代一个重要的领域,开发安卓或 IOS 应用都需要通过一种设计工具来创建其原型,从而帮助团队在未编写代码之前更好地定义和讨论产品的功能和流程,这就是草图软件。本文将对草图软件在移动应用程序设计中的应用和原理进行详细介绍。一、什么
2023-05-06
5分钟开发手机app
开发手机app一直以来都是一个高门槛的事情,需要掌握多种编程语言和框架,还需要有较强的设计能力。但是,近年来出现了一些利用模板、快速开发工具等方式来简化app开发的方法,下面就来介绍其中的一种方法:无代码开发工具。无代码开发工具是一种新兴的app开发方式,
2023-05-04